Node canvas examples. js using canvas, compatible with...

  • Node canvas examples. js using canvas, compatible with Chart. js! Follow a step-by-step guide to get up to speed with Chart. It is built on Google's Chrome V8 open-source JavaScript engine. Live Canvas — agent-driven visual workspace with A2UI. 11. JS v4. js® is a free, open-source, cross-platform JavaScript runtime environment that lets developers create servers, web apps, command line tools and scripts. More than 150 million people use GitHub to discover, fork, and contribute to over 420 million projects. Sample usage: Using from Node. It provides declarative and reactive bindings to the Konva Framework. - node-canvas/Readme. Builders can get started with a blank canvas or with prebuilt templates. Node canvas is a Cairo backed Canvas implementation for NodeJS. Latest version: 1. In this episode, Ulf Schwekendiek will teach us how to use node-canvas to create our own custom, dynamically generated images. Get help with writing, planning, brainstorming, and more. Companion apps — macOS menu bar app + iOS/Android nodes. 0, last published: 6 months ago. Canvas is a 2D drawing API used in web browsers to render shapes, images, and text onto a graphical surface. 0) - Released 2018-06-12 (Release Info) Sep 23, 2025 · Node. Among the interfacing API, in some cases the drawing API has been extended for SSJS image manipulation / creation usage, however keep in mind these additions may fail to render properly within browsers. Create a Chart In this example, we create a bar chart for a Generate, edit, and enhance images, videos, and 3D assets with Krea's creative AI suite. Simplify documentation and avoid heavy tools. Uses the libvips library. node-canvas-example Learn how to draw and save an image programatically using NodeJS and node-canvas package Full tutorial: Drawing and saving image using node-canvas package The node-canvas package is a NodeJS module allows you to create an image programatically. We do not recommend using a Node installer, since the Node installation process installs npm in a directory with local permissions and can cause permissions errors when you run npm packages globally. While it is most well-known as the scripting language for Web pages, many non-browser environments also use it, such as Node. js is a JavaScript runtime. Bring data to life with SVG, Canvas and HTML. Generate Dynamic Images with node-canvas Creating dynamic images unlocks a whole world of powerful workflows. It lets you execute JavaScript code outside of a web browser, enabling server-side development with JavaScript. In this tutorial, you'll learn: What is Node. Use this online chartjs-node-canvas playground to view and fork chartjs-node-canvas example apps and templates on CodeSandbox. . js? Node. JavaScript is a prototype-based, garbage-collected, dynamic language, supporting multiple paradigms such as Looking to take your HTML5 animations to the next level? Get inspired by these 25 extremely cool examples of canvas in HTML5! How to create a pie chart using NodeJs with chartjs? want to create different types of charts using chartjs but when I tried to run the code shows "cannot set the property of width" TypeError: Can html2canvas is a JavaScript library that captures HTML elements as images, enabling screenshots, thumbnails, and dynamic graphics creation. It uses an event-driven, non-blocking I/O model. js from theory to practice. Upload your own images as reference. js from source and a list of supported platforms. Building Node. First-class tools — browser, canvas, nodes, cron, sessions, and Discord/Slack actions. js is a vast topic that you can't learn entirely from a single shorter article, I've done my best to cover some of the essential features to help you get started with the journey. js Alternatively, see the example below or check samples. MindNode helps you capture, connect, and evolve ideas visually as mind maps and outlines. Not many elements are needed with a Dot Calender: Circles and text. pdfmake, client/server side PDF printing in pure JavaScript Version 3. Commonly used for explaining your code! Mermaid is a simple markdown-like script language for generating charts from text via javascript. - Automattic/node-canvas Use the OpenAI Agent Builder to start from templates, compose nodes, preview runs, and export workflows to code. Easy mindmapping software. js You can use Chart. react-konva is a JavaScript library for drawing complex canvas graphics using React. Although Node. Meet Gemini, Google’s AI assistant. Start using chartjs-node-canvas in your project by running `npm i chartjs-node-canvas`. Open source Visio Alternative. High performance Node. js) is an open-source, cross-platform runtime environment that allows developers to create all kinds of server-side tools and applications in JavaScript. Experience the power of generative AI. The most productive online mind map canvas on the Web. This tutorial describes how to use the <canvas> element to draw 2D graphics, starting with the basics. This article explains how, and provides a couple of basic use cases. Generate AI images using Flux AI, ChatGPT, Imagen, Ideogram, and more. It allows you to run JavaScript code outside the browser, making it ideal for building scalable server-side and networking applications. js depends on node-canvas for a canvas implementation (HTMLCanvasElement replacement) and jsdom for a window implementation on node. Node NodeAttribute NodeBuilder NodeCache NodeCode NodeFrame NodeFunction NodeFunctionInput NodeParser NodeUniform NodeVar NodeVarying NormalMapNode Object3DNode OperatorNode OutputStructNode PMREMNode PackFloatNode ParameterNode PassMultipleTextureNode PassNode PassTextureNode PhongLightingModel PhysicalLightingModel PointLightNode Node-Canvas is a Node. js from npm or a CDN Integrate Chart. - lovell/sharp GitHub is where people build software. js image processing, the fastest module to resize JPEG, PNG, WebP, AVIF and TIFF images. Sample usage: QRCode / 2d Barcode api with both server side and client side support using canvas. Latest LTS Version: 8. toDataURL() method returns a data URL containing a representation of the image in the format specified by the type parameter. Canvas Node Canvas is a powerful image library for NodeJS. js” is strongly discouraged as it poses security risks and may cause issues with minification. It primarily uses the npm package ecosystem. Using from Node. Notice the above example uses a file path, not a relative URL like the other examples. A node renderer for Chart. A compound parent node does not have independent dimensions (position and size), as those values are automatically inferred by the positions and dimensions of the descendant nodes. 0. js and npm. js using canvas. Store documents online and access them from any computer. js with bundlers, loaders, and front-end frameworks Use Chart. We’re a talent solutions and advisory company, committed to empowering professionals and organizations to achieve bold ambitions through care and innovation. js (13973:30): Use of eval in “node_modules/three/examples/jsm/libs/lottie_canvas. js package that provides a server-side implementation of the HTML5 Canvas API. There are 68 other projects in the npm registry using chartjs-node-canvas. Did you know you can use Node. module. As far as the API is concerned, compound nodes are treated just like regular nodes — except in explicitly compound functions like node. 0 now available Skia Canvas is a Node. Learn how to hand off an agent conversation to a human agent, complete with context and conversation history. js Install Chart. Onboarding + skills — wizard-driven setup with bundled/managed/workspace skills. Latest version: 5. And I wanted to leave different configurations open. Version CategoriesExamples Download20060 Size3 MB Create DateDecember 3, 2015 Last UpdatedApril 7, 2025Play List Download Educational example scenes for Behaviour Trees | State Machines | Dialogue Trees. js implementation of the HTML Canvas drawing API for both on- and off-screen rendering. Jul 11, 2022 · In this article, we've covered Node. Node-Canvas is a Node. js is a powerful, open-source, and cross-platform JavaScript runtime environment built on Chrome's V8 engine. Start for free with real-time tools, powerful models, and collaborative workflows. That’s it. js in Node. The HTMLCanvasElement. parent(). :bar_chart::chart_with_upwards_trend::tada: - d3/d3 Konva is an HTML5 Canvas JavaScript framework that enables high performance animations, transitions, node nesting, layering, filtering, caching, event handling for desktop and mobile applications, and much more. Skia Canvas is a Node. Sep 11, 2025 · Node (or more formally Node. One of the most interesting features of the Web Audio API is the ability to extract frequency, waveform, and other data from your audio source, which can then be used to create visualizations. The examples provided should give you some clear ideas about what you can do with canvas, and will provide code snippets that may get you started in building your own content. Well organized and easy to understand Web building tutorials with lots of examples of how to use HTML, CSS, JavaScript, SQL, Python, PHP, Bootstrap, Java, XML and more. Since it uses Google’s Skia graphics engine, its output is very similar to Chrome’s <canvas> element — though it's also capable of things the browser’s Canvas still can't achieve. js to generate a meta image for some pieces of content, like a blog post? Learn more here. 4, last published: a year ago. Node. , running directly on a computer or server OS). It supports preview runs, inline eval configuration, and full versioning—ideal for fast iteration. This post explores a small weekend project that combines Node. An example of how to use node-canvas to create an animation as a GIF and a Video - tmcw/node-canvas-animation-example Canvas is not the problem, it’s math! For developers the configurability of things is quite natural. js. This means that you may encounter node-canvas limitations and bugs. Choose styles and presets. Follow these instructions to get node-canvas up and running. js from Node. JavaScript (JS) is a lightweight interpreted (or just-in-time compiled) programming language with first-class functions. js guide with tutorials, API documentation, and interactive playground. In the browser, the artwork renders in real-time. The package uses Cairo 2D graphics library so that you can generate an image in many common formats like JPG, JPEG or PNG. js - jsdom/jsdom Agent Builder ⁠ provides a visual canvas for composing logic with drag-and-drop nodes, connecting tools, and configuring custom guardrails. Start using qrcode in your project by running `npm i qrcode`. All the best text to image models in one place. The runtime is intended for use outside of a browser context (i. In particular, Skia One thing to note is that you need to provide a valid image source for the node-canvas Image rather than a DOM Image. md for instructions on how to build Node. Create and edit web-based documents, spreadsheets, and presentations. So to start, set up a node project and install canvas: npm install canvas --save To draw a circle you use arc: Use this online chartjs-node-canvas playground to view and fork chartjs-node-canvas example apps and templates on CodeSandbox. Free online mind mapping. Node. e. js for server-side generation of plots with help from an NPM package such as node-canvas or skia-canvas. Comprehensive Node. 5. js, Apache CouchDB and Adobe Acrobat. md at master · Automattic/node-canvas A JavaScript implementation of various web standards, for use with Node. We strongly recommend using a Node version manager like nvm to install Node. Supports Freemind mindmap import/export. - buffcode/chartjs-node-canvas Fabric. NodeCanvas is the complete node-based Visual Behavior Authoring framework for Unity, enabling you to create believable AI behaviors and logic without the fuss in an intuitive visual graph editor, including three powerful, separate, yet fully interchangeable and fully featured graph modules for you to choose and easily add in your games. js is a free, open-source JavaScript runtime that runs on Windows, Mac, Linux, and more. Learn server-side JavaScript development with Node. 6. js and HTML5 Canvas to create high-resolution generative artwork. Open source HTML5 Charts for your website Getting Started Let's get started with Chart. js See BUILDING. In this article I will show you how to use sharp and node-canvas packages to generate images inside a Docker container. node_modules/three/examples/jsm/libs/lottie_canvas. node-canvas extends the canvas API to provide interfacing with node, for example streaming PNG data, converting to a Buffer instance, etc. It implements the Web Canvas API, so anything you can do inside a <canvas> can be done with Node Canvas. There are 4079 other projects in the npm registry using qrcode. Learn how to build agents and workflows with OpenAI and AgentKit. 3 (includes npm 5. kyzid, kxd3h, q3xam, 8dzh, jbkatf, dv5yd, lsejd, ziv0mx, 955ecn, njjxuj,